DS90UB638TRGZRQ1 by Texas Instruments is a 48-terminal line receiver with open-drain output, operating at -40 to 105 °C. It has a max supply voltage of 1.155 V and can handle up to 2 Amp output low current. Ideal for automotive applications due to AEC-Q100 screening level and nickel palladium gold terminal finish.
